At A Glance
The Ozone Edge has long been one of the defining kites in Ozone’s range, a benchmark for speed, hangtime, and upwind drive. Now in its 13th iteration (the “VT” stands for Version Thirteen), the Edge continues to evolve while keeping its core DNA intact.
The new lineup spans 6 to 13m in one-metre steps, plus 15m and 18m options for light-wind sessions. The 12m is new for this release, along with the 15 and 18m sizes; this narrows the gap from the 13m to the 17m and 19m last year. The new 12m is a welcome addition, hitting the sweet spot freeride size many riders love.
Ozone has re-engineered the construction by size: smaller kites (6–9m) use full Teijin triple-ripstop Dacron for strength and durability, mid-sizes (10–13m) feature a hybrid 125g Dacron/ Teijin triple-ripstop Dacron mix, and the big sizes (15–18m) use 125g Dacron to reduce weight and improve the flying characteristics.
Updates for the new kite include increased canopy tension, especially at the trailing edge, to reduce flutter and improve performance. The planform and arc of the kite has been refined for quicker handling and more responsive turning, and a new 16-point bridle, inspired by the Vortex, gives the leading edge incredible stability.
This new bridle allows Ozone to reduce leading-edge diameter without losing stiffness. The result: a faster, more aerodynamic kite that drives forward effortlessly while retaining that bulletproof Edge feel.
It's a five strut design to give the most rigid platform possible for big air and as usual the Ozone build quality is second to none.
Sizes: 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 15, 18m
Recommended Bar Set up: 55cm with 23m Lines
In the Air
From the first dive, the Edge VT feels familiar yet sharper. The bar pressure is slightly lighter than before, but not so much that you lose connection; you always know where the kite is, and there is plenty of feedback for the rider. Steering response is immediate; pull the bar, and it reacts instantly; there is no lag, no delay, just direct, precise feedback. This is largely thanks to the tighter tension in the trailing edge. When you engage the bar, that tighter tension allows the kite to respond instantaneously.
That new, tighter trailing edge also eliminates flutter. The canopy stays silent and composed even when fully sheeted out in gusty conditions. This allows the kite to fly further forward in the window with less drag, giving you more speed and better upwind angles.
This dynamic, speedy nature gives the kite impressive boosting capabilities. The Edge VT still reigns supreme in the freeride big-air arena. It accelerates hard across the window, rockets you skyward, and holds you there with ridiculous hangtime. It’s the kind of float that lets you take a look around mid-flight, plan your landing, and still come down smoothly. More than this, though, this performance is effortless to access; it’s plug-and-play, reassuring, and confidence-inspiring.
Upwind, the performance is classic Edge: incredible drive and efficiency. The thinner leading edge lets it fly further forward in the window, making those long runs back to the beach or up the coast effortless. That efficiency also makes it surprisingly good fun for foiling, especially in lighter winds where the power delivery is predictable and smooth.
And while it’s built for freeride and big air, the Edge VT’s forgiving nature makes it approachable. It’s fast, but not intimidating; robust, yet stable. You can push your limits without the kite punishing your mistakes.
Overall
The Edge VT continues Ozone’s tradition of refining, not reinventing, what already works. It’s the ultimate freeride kite for riders who crave speed, lift, and control coupled with ease of use and a forgiving nature.
The 16-point bridle, tighter canopy, and refined shaping give it a distinctly modern feel—clean, composed, and confidence-inspiring. Whether you’re chasing height on a twin tip, blasting upwind on a foil, or just enjoying a cruisy freeride session, the Edge VT delivers incredible performance across the board. It’s forgiving, easy to ride and will excite you every time you launch it.
